Louisa, Kentucky appears in the C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System with 1,321 registered healthcare providers spanning 20 distinct NUCC-taxonomy specialties. This count includes every individual clinician who has applied for an NPI and listed a practice address in Louisa — physicians, dentists,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, chiropractors, physical therapists, optometrists, psychologists, podiatrists, and every other credentialed provider type CMS tracks. It does not measure hospital beds, urgent-care capacity, or whether a given clinic is accepting new patients; it measures the pool of professionals with current NPI enrollment and a Louisa practice location on file. The provider mix in Louisa is weighted toward Peer Specialist (764 clinicians, followed by Case Manager/Care Coordinator with 105 and Addiction (Substance Use Disorder) Counselor with 58). That distribution reflects how NPPES records specialty: providers self-select a primary taxonomy code, so a family physician who also practices geriatrics will show up under whichever NUCC code they registered first.
